5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While internet poker brings many advantages, it's not without its difficulties. The significant downsides may be the potential for deceptive activities, including collusion and chip dumping, in which players cheat to get an unfair advantage. However, reputable on-line poker systems employ robust protection steps and arbitrary quantity generators to thwart these types of behavior. In addition, some people could find the lack of real cues and interactions that are section of real time poker games a disadvantage, as it can be harder to learn opponents and employ mental techniques online.
